Transaction 07f6107ef3f4a3832500632eea9401e9abca7e5859146e5fd489d9cb033abd43

1 Input
2 Outputs
  • 07f6107ef3f4a3832500632eea9401e9abca7e5859146e5fd489d9cb033abd43:0
  • value  59000000
    address  13pi8zZcJyBTET6ZVdkJrvrwoaymy6N4qc
  • 07f6107ef3f4a3832500632eea9401e9abca7e5859146e5fd489d9cb033abd43:1
  • value  40891561
    address  1PLyhkugcXpM5ZUDiCvy2ZaYD6xA3JbW86